RankoupFred36 minutes ago Cool setup, like that one has to be a little active to be able to post. I did schedule a post for my project, nice intuitive process for launching a project. Would maybe make the badge verification requirement a little more subtle, although I get the idea of using it to also promote the site on top of verifying ownership of the website.
All in all a nice and well built site.
Best of luck!